Woodgate Primary Academy
41 Bellevue Farm Road, Pease Pottage, Crawley RH11 9GT
Woodgate Primary Academy is an academy. It has 27 staff (about 18 FTEs), including 9 teachers (about 8 FTEs). The present school opened in 2023.
Particular strengths include Unfilled vacancies, Qualified teachers and Staff development. Relative weaknesses include Assistant:teacher ratio.

Unfilled vacancies: Excellent. The proportion of unfilled or temporarily filled teaching positions is 0%, which is very low compared to other schools.
Qualified teachers: Excellent. The proportion of qualified teachers is about 100%, which is very high compared to other schools.
Staff development: Excellent. Reported staff development spend is £1855 per teacher per year, which is very high compared to other schools.
Assistant:teacher ratio: Poor. The number of assistants per teacher is about 0.37, which is very low compared to other schools.
